What is the Short Stay History and Physical Form?
The Short Stay History and Physical Form serves a vital function in the medical community by capturing comprehensive patient medical history. This form plays a crucial role in pre-operative assessments, ensuring that healthcare providers have all necessary information before a procedure. It is commonly utilized by hospitals and clinics, making it an essential document for patient care.

Key Features of the Short Stay History and Physical Form
This form includes essential sections that contribute to its effectiveness. Vital elements encompass:
-
Vital signs and current medications
-
Allergies and previous medical history
-
Examination notes and signatures

Who needs to fill out the Short Stay History and Physical Form?
Patients who are scheduled for a short-stay procedure must complete this form. Healthcare providers and medical staff also use it to ensure they have accurate patient medical history for safe treatment planning.
What information should I gather before filling out the form?
Gather details about your medical history, current medications, any known allergies, and information about previous surgeries. Having this information readily available will help you complete the form accurately.
